Key Insights

The global cardiac implant closure device market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ing prevalence of congenital heart defects (CHDs), patent foramen ovale (PFO), and left atrial appendage (LAA) requiring closure. Technological advancements leading to less invasive procedures, improved device designs with higher success rates, and a growing aging population susceptible to atrial fibrillation (AFib) – a condition often treated with LAA closure devices – are key drivers. The market is segmented by device type (CHDs, PFO, LAA closures) and application (hospitals, clinics), with hospitals currently holding the largest market share due to the complexity of procedures. Leading players like Abbott, Boston Scientific, and Occlutech are driving innovation and competition, resulting in a dynamic market landscape. The North American market currently dominates, benefiting from advanced healthcare infrastructure and higher adoption rates, followed by Europe and Asia-Pacific regions exhibiting significant growth potential due to rising healthcare expenditure and increasing awareness. While challenges exist, such as high procedure costs and potential complications, the overall market trajectory points towards sustained expansion throughout the forecast period.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Cardiac Implant Closure Device Market?

Several key factors are driving the remarkable growth of the cardiac implant closure device market. Firstly, the aging global population is significantly increasing the prevalence of cardiovascular diseases, including atrial septal defects (ASDs) and patent foramen ovale (PFOs), which are common indications for these closure devices. Secondly, advancements in minimally invasive cardiac procedures are making these devices a more attractive and less risky alternative to traditional open-heart surgery. This translates into shorter hospital stays, faster recovery times, and reduced overall healthcare costs. Technological innovations continuously improve the safety and efficacy of these devices, leading to better patient outcomes and increased adoption rates. The growing awareness among healthcare professionals and patients about the benefits of these devices further contributes to market expansion. Furthermore, supportive regulatory frameworks and reimbursement policies in various countries are encouraging wider adoption and market penetration. Increasing healthcare expenditure, particularly in developing economies, is fueling access to advanced medical technologies such as cardiac implant closure devices, resulting in increased market demand. Finally, the rising prevalence of atrial fibrillation and the associated risks are driving the growth of the left atrial appendage (LAA) closure device segment.

Challenges and Restraints in Cardiac Implant Closure Device Market

Despite the significant growth potential, the cardiac implant closure device market faces certain challenges. High initial costs associated with these devices can limit access, especially in resource-constrained healthcare settings. The need for specialized training and expertise for implantation procedures poses a hurdle in some regions, particularly in developing countries. Potential complications following implantation, though relatively rare, can create apprehension among patients and healthcare providers. Stringent regulatory approvals and clinical trials are essential for ensuring device safety and efficacy, but can also slow down the market entry of new products. Furthermore, intense competition among established players and the emergence of new competitors can create price pressure and affect profitability. The potential for adverse events, although low, always necessitates rigorous quality control and post-market surveillance. Finally, variations in healthcare reimbursement policies across different countries can impact the market dynamics and the affordability of these devices.
